#systemd #Debian

J'ai bien un "After=network.target" mais, malgré ça, un service démarre parfois avant que la directive "up" dans /etc/network/interfaces soit exécutée (et donc le service échoue). Est-ce normal, docteur ?

Bon, apparemment, la seule solution qui marche, c'est la chloraquine. Non, je rigole, la seule qui a marché pour moi, c'est :

ExecStartPre=/bin/sh -c 'until ip addr show | grep 2001:X:Y::Z; do sleep 1; done;'

#systemd

@bortzmeyer As-tu essayé network-online.target au lieu de network.target ? (Wants et After)

Follow

@bortzmeyer pardon, effectivement j’ai pas fait mes devoirs avant de répondre...

Sign in to participate in the conversation
Mastodon

mastodon.immae.eu is one server in the network